Audiotec Fischer Helix 6 Channel Amplifier - M SIX
One for all – no matter if 3-way, 2-way or subwoofer application, the 6-channel amplifier M SIX will always be the right choice. With generously 100 Watts RMS per channel into both 4 Ohms and 2 Ohms load this amp really gets your speaker cones going despite its super-compact dimensions. On the other hand the M SIX stays totally cool thanks to its highly efficient Class D design topology. And even bridged configurations are possible, delivering up to 3 x 200 Watts RMS of clean and undistorted output power. In addition a comprehensive and stunningly practical feature set leaves nothing to be desired. And finally the perfect sound tuning is no big deal thanks to its integrated crossover with all its setup options.
Key Features
- Start-Stop capability
The switched power supply of the HELIX M SIX assures operation even if the battery’s voltage drops down to 6 Volts during engine crank.
Features
- Small footprint Class D amplifier with high output power of 100 Watts RMS @ 4 and 2 Ohms load
- Start-Stop capability down to 6V supply voltage
- 6-channel lowlevel input
- Integrated, active crossover with highpass, lowpass, bandpass and subsonic
- “Input mode” switch for channel E & F for flexible input signal routing
- SMD (Surface Mounted Device) manufacturing technology combines minimum space requirement with maximum reliability
- Exclusive, extremely compact and clean design with illuminated HELIX-logo and low heat dissipation thanks to extraordinary efficiency
Specifications
- Output power RMS / max.
- @ 4 Ohms: 6 x 100 / 200 Watts
- @ 2 Ohms: 6 x 100 / 200 Watts
- Bridged @ 4 Ohms: 3 x 200 / 400 Watts
- Amplifier technology: Class D
- Inputs:
- 6 x RCA / Cinch
- 1 x Remote In
- Input sensitivity: RCA / Cinch 0.5 - 6 Volts
- Input impedance RCA / Cinch: 20 kOhms
- Outputs: 6 x Speaker output
- Frequency response: 10 Hz - 30,000 Hz
- Highpass: 15 Hz - 4,000 Hz adjustable
- Lowpass: 40 Hz - 4,000 Hz adjustable
- Bandpass: 15 Hz - 4,000 Hz adjustable
- Subsonic / HPF: 15 Hz - 4,000 Hz adjustable
- Slope high- / lowpass: 12 dB/Oct.
- Signal-to-noise ratio analog input: 98 dB (A-weighted)
- Distortion (THD): 0.05%
- Damping factor: 100
- Operating voltage: 10.5 - 16 Volts (max. 5 sec. down to 6 Volts)
- Idle current: 1,550 mA
- Fuse: 2 x 35 A Maxi-fuse (APX)
